Irish Terrier vs Lakeland Terrier

People compare Irish and Lakeland Terriers because they’re both rugged, spirited terriers with wiry coats and a knack for keeping life interesting. You’re drawn to them for the same reason. loyalty with a side of mischief, dogs that’ll hike all day then curl up like they’ve always belonged. But under the surface, they’re built for different kinds of chaos. The Irish Terrier is the bigger, bolder companion. At 27 pounds and nearly 18 inches tall, he’s got presence. like a terrier turned up just a notch. He’s deeply affectionate with kids, nearly as much as he is with his person, making him a better fit if you’ve got a busy household with younger children running around. He wants to be in the middle of it all, on a farm, on a trail, or beside you in a well-exercised suburban yard. But don’t slack on walks. Without it, that mental stimulation score means he’ll find his own entertainment. probably involving your shoes. The Lakeland is smaller, tighter, and feistier in temperament. He was bred to go after foxes in rocky fells, so he’s more independent, less eager to please. That doesn’t mean he’s not loving. he’s fiercely loyal. but he won’t be quite as forgiving of toddler energy. Families with older kids who respect boundaries will do better. He sheds less than most, great for allergies, but both breeds need coat stripping to keep that classic terrier look. Here’s the real talk: both will bark, dig, and chase squirrels like it’s their job. But the Irish feels like family in a heartbeat. he’ll break your heart with how hard he tries to love you. The Lakeland? He’ll earn your trust, and that bond runs deep. Choose the Irish if you want a devoted partner. Choose the Lakeland if you’re ready to win his respect every day.
